Firing in Peshawar hotel; armed gunman shot dead
Peshawar, May 10: Loud firing was heard inside Bangash hotel in Dabgari area of Peshawar province of Pakistan on Tuesday, May 10 morning.
The gunman reportedly fired aerial shots and also opened fire on security personnel. The incident occurred at the Bangash Hotel in interior Peshawar city that falls under the jurisdiction of Shah Qabool Police Station.

Police received information that a tribesman was firing aerial shots. He was firing shots at short intervals from the ventilator of his hotel room.
Police rushed to the site and the tribesman, hailing from North Waziristan Agency, started firing on them to which the police party retaliated.
The tribesman was killed in the police firing. He was identified as Aayah Jan, a retired employee of Frontier Corps. The police recovered a pistol from his hotel room.
